Background
THRβ (Thyroid Hormone Receptor Beta, also known as ERBA2) is a nuclear hormone receptor for triiodothyronine. It is one of the several receptors for thyroid hormone, and has been shown to mediate the biological activities of thyroid hormone. Knockout studies in mice suggest that the different receptors, while having certain extent of redundancy, may mediate different functions of thyroid hormone. THRβ is a high affinity receptor for thyroid hormones,including triiodothyronine and thyroxine. It can act as a repressor or activator of transcription.

Protein Details
Recombinant human THRβ protein was expressed in a baculovirus expression system as the full length protein (accession number NP_000452.2) with an N-terminal FLAG tag. The molecular weight of the protein is 54.1 kDa.
Storage
Recombinant proteins in solution are temperature sensitive and must be stored at -80°C to prevent degradation. Avoid repeated freeze/thaw cycles and keep on ice when not in storage.
